1 |
By the rivers of
Babylon,
There we sat down, yea, we wept
When we remembered Zion.
|
|
|
2 |
We hung our harps
Upon the willows in the midst of it.
|
|
3 |
For there those who
carried us away captive asked of us a song,
And those who plundered us requested mirth,
Saying, “Sing us one of the songs of Zion!”
|
|
4 |
How shall we sing
the LORD’s song
In a foreign land?
|
|
5 |
If I forget you, O
Jerusalem,
Let my right hand forget its skill!
|
|
6 |
If I do not remember
you,
Let my tongue cling to the roof of my mouth —
If I do not exalt Jerusalem
Above my chief joy.
|
|
7 |
Remember, O LORD,
against the sons of Edom
The day of Jerusalem,
Who said, “Raze it, raze it,
To its very foundation!”
|
|
8 |
O daughter of
Babylon, who are to be destroyed,
Happy the one who repays you as you have served us!
|
|
9 |
Happy the one who
takes and dashes
Your little ones against the rock!
